This market refers to which team hits the greater number of sixes in the cricket match between Ipswich and Western Suburbs scheduled for 2026-08-25 in KFC T20 Max. The outcome corresponding to Ipswich will be considered correct if Ipswich is officially recorded as hitting more sixes than Western Suburbs.The outcome corresponding to Western Suburbs will be considered correct if Western Suburbs is officially recorded as hitting more sixes than Ipswich. If both teams record the same number of sixes, the market will resolve to "Draw". The market will resolve according to the team that hits the greater number of sixes in the match regardless of if the match is not competed (e.g. Due to weather conditions)/ Only sixes scored from the bat (off any delivery- legal or not) will count towards the total sixes. Overthrows and extras do not count. Sixes scored in a super over do not count. In First Class games, only first innings sixes will count. If the match is permanently canceled, abandoned, or otherwise completed without official sixes statistics being recorded, the market will resolve "Draw". If the match is postponed or rescheduled, the market remains open until the listed fixture is completed and official statistics are available.
